Overnight Worker
This position supports the mission by providing assistance to residents during the night and ensures the safety and security of the home. It also includes tasks that aid case management, general facility operations, clerical, and general office tasks. This position collaborates with and is supervised by the Program Coordinator. This is an overnight, awake shift that includes weekends. Work hours are 9:45pm-7:45am and include a weekend shift.  

The ideal candidate is someone who is a caring person and who works well independently to complete tasks. Wage is dependent on education and experience. Computer skills with MS suite (i.e. excel, word) needed. HS diploma or GED required. Additional training or education a plus but not required. One year experience in social services preferred. Fresh Start values lived experience and that may be substituted for education or job experience. People of color and other historically marginalized groups are encouraged to apply. This is a part - time position for 30 hours per week and includes health benefits. Position open until filled; applicants are encouraged to apply by May 15, 2024. Internships
Internships can help you develop your experience in non-profits by learning the ropes from more experienced professionals. At the end of your internship, you’ll have relevant experience to help you decide if a career in the non-profit industry is the right choice for you. At a smaller non-profit like Fresh Start, you’ll have an opportunity to see your projects go from start to finish.
